What happened: The Vancouver Whitecaps are shifting operations to Swangard Stadium for their upcoming Canadian Championship quarterfinal. Ryan Gauld noted the importance of delivering a result that honors the organization's 86ers era. Midfielder Sebastian Berhalter highlighted the unique energy expected from the local supporters.

Why it matters: The venue operated as the franchise's primary home before the modern transition to BC Place. This temporary relocation provides a rare opportunity to bridge the current MLS roster with the club's foundational traditions. Establishing an early lead in the domestic tournament is critical for advancing in the competition.

What to watch: The squad will finalize tactical preparations ahead of the opening whistle. Vancouver aims to leverage the intimate crowd for a crucial first-leg advantage.
